Chapter5 MachineVision
©NationalInstruments Corporation 5-7 IMAQVision for LabWindows/CVI User Manual
ChoosingaMethodtoBuildtheCoordinateTransformThefollowing fl owchart guides you through choosing the best method for
building a coordinate transform for your application.
Figure5-4. Buildinga Coordinate Transform
Start
Yes
Yes
Yes
Yes
Yes
No
No
No
No
Objectpositioning
accuracybetter
than±65 degrees.
Theobject under
inspectionhas a straight,
distinctedge (main axis).
Theobject contains
asecond distinct edge not
parallelto the main axis in a
separatesearch area.
Theobject contains a
seconddistinct edge not parallel
tothe main axis in the same
searcharea.
Builda coordinate
transformationbased on
edgedetection using two
distinctsearch areas.
Builda
coordinatetransformation
basedon edge detection
usinga single search area.
Objectpositioning
accuracybetter
than±5 degrees.
Builda coordinate
transformationbased on
patternmatching
shiftinvariant strategy.
Builda coordinate
transformationbased on
patternmatching
rotationinvariant strategy.
End
No